Advanced Bidding Strategies and Budget Allocation
AI has revolutionized PPC bidding strategies. Gone are the days of purely manual bid adjustments. Today, platforms like Google Ads offer sophisticated AI-driven options such as Target ROAS (Return On Ad Spend) and Maximize Conversion Value, which use machine learning to set bids at auction time. These algorithms consider a multitude of signals, including device type, location, time of day, audience segment, and even weather patterns, to predict the likelihood of a conversion and adjust bids accordingly. This granular, real-time optimization is something no human could replicate. For example, a Target ROAS strategy might automatically increase bids for users in downtown Atlanta during lunch hours if historical data suggests higher conversion rates for that specific demographic and time slot.
Beyond individual bids, AI also plays a critical role in dynamic budget allocation. Instead of fixed daily or monthly budgets per campaign, AI can intelligently shift funds between campaigns, ad groups, or even different advertising platforms based on real-time performance. If an AI model detects that a particular ad group on a social media platform is significantly outperforming others in terms of conversion value, it can automatically reallocate a portion of the budget from underperforming campaigns to capitalize on that opportunity. This agile approach prevents budget stagnation and ensures that ad spend is always directed towards the areas yielding the highest return. I’ve witnessed campaigns where AI redistributed as much as 30% of the daily budget between channels, resulting in a 10% increase in overall campaign ROAS within a week.
However, implementing these advanced strategies requires careful oversight. While AI automates much of the decision-making, it still needs clear objectives and guardrails. Defining precise conversion values, setting realistic ROAS targets, and regularly reviewing performance data are paramount. Without proper calibration, AI might optimize for metrics that don’t align with broader business goals. For instance, if you only track “clicks” as a conversion, AI will optimize for clicks, potentially at the expense of actual sales. It’s about providing the AI with the right signals to learn from, a process that often involves integrating first-party data from CRM systems or e-commerce platforms to give the algorithms a richer understanding of customer lifetime value.

Measuring and Interpreting AI-Driven Performance
Interpreting the performance of AI-driven PPC campaigns requires a nuanced approach. Traditional metrics like CPA and ROAS remain important, but AI introduces new layers of analysis. Marketers must understand how the AI is making decisions, which signals it prioritizes, and how these choices impact overall campaign trajectory. This often involves looking beyond surface-level dashboards and diving into the platform’s reporting on bid adjustments, audience segments, and creative variations tested. The “black box” nature of some AI algorithms can be a challenge, making it difficult to fully understand why certain decisions were made. This is why platforms are increasingly focusing on explainable AI (XAI) to provide more transparency into their models.
One critical aspect of measurement is anomaly detection. AI systems are excellent at identifying sudden drops in performance or unusual spikes in cost that might indicate an issue, such as a broken landing page, a competitor launching an aggressive campaign, or even ad fraud. These systems can alert marketers in real-time, allowing for immediate intervention before significant budget is wasted. For instance, if an AI detects a 20% drop in conversion rate for a specific ad group within an hour, it can flag this for review, preventing a full day of underperformance. This proactive monitoring is a significant advantage over manual review processes, which often identify problems long after they’ve caused financial impact.
On top of that, AI assists in attribution modeling. In a complex customer journey involving multiple touchpoints across various channels, accurately attributing conversions can be challenging. AI-powered attribution models can analyze vast amounts of data to determine the true impact of each touchpoint, moving beyond simplistic last-click attribution. This provides a more accurate picture of which campaigns and channels are truly driving value, allowing for better budget allocation in the future. Understanding the full conversion path, as interpreted by AI, helps marketers understand the synergistic effects of their multi-channel efforts. Without this, you’re often flying blind, attributing success to the last interaction rather than the cumulative effect of your marketing ecosystem.
Challenges and Future Outlook for AI in PPC
Despite its immense benefits, integrating AI into PPC workflows presents challenges. Data quality is paramount; “garbage in, garbage out” applies emphatically to AI. If the data fed into AI models is incomplete, inaccurate, or biased, the AI’s decisions will reflect those flaws, leading to suboptimal or even detrimental campaign performance. Ensuring clean, complete, and ethically sourced data remains a significant hurdle for many organizations. This often requires strong data governance policies and integration with various first-party data sources, such as CRM and ERP systems, which can be complex to implement.
Another challenge is the need for skilled talent. While AI automates many tasks, it requires human expertise to set strategic goals, interpret results, and refine algorithms. Marketers need to evolve from tactical executors to strategic architects, understanding how to effectively communicate with and guide AI systems. This means developing skills in data analysis, machine learning concepts, and critical thinking to question and validate AI’s recommendations. The job role of a PPC manager is shifting. It’s less about manual bid adjustments and more about strategic oversight and data interpretation.
